OpenFIGI Filter API

The Filter API from OpenFIGI — 1 operation(s) for filter.

OpenFIGI Filter API is one of 3 APIs that OpenFIGI publ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.

Tagged areas include Filter.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ification and API documentation.

This API exposes 1 operation across 1 path, and defines 10 schemas. It is described by OpenAPI 3.0.0, at version 2.0.0.

Requests are made against a single base URL, https://api.openfigi.com/{basePath}.

Authentication & Security 1

OpenFIGI Filter API declares 1 security scheme for authenticating requests. An API key is passed in the header as X-OPENFIGI-APIKEY (ApiKeyAuth). By default, every request must be authenticated, though some operations may also be called without credentials.

Paths & Operations 1

Across 1 path, the API surfaces 1 operation — 1 POST. Each is listed below with its method, path, parameters, and response codes.

Filter 1
POST
/filter
Search for FIGIs using key words and other filters. The results are listed alphabetically by FIGI and include the number of results.
